Solved most of the problems meentime :)

Importents point of all: stand-alone-logger stop logging emediantly, if requested value is not awailible on CAN..

Stand-alone-logger uses single value poll, so sampling rate is not very fast.
Is there any chance to use DAQ-list of all requested values and increase sample rate ?

Subarus SSM-IV logs "all" awailible values (90 values and 44 switches) of EURO5 Diesels via DAQ-Lists and get sample rats of 300ms for all.
So a DAQ-List of 20 values can go in about 50ms or less
